引言
近年来,随着人工智能技术的飞速发展,大模型(拥有数千亿参数)在自然语言处理、计算机视觉、语音识别等领域取得了显著的成果。然而,大模型的训练和应用也面临着诸多挑战。本文将从大模型的参数、训练过程、应用场景以及面临的挑战等方面进行详细探讨。
一、大模型的参数
1. 参数的定义
大模型的参数是指模型中所有可调整的权重和偏置,它们决定了模型的输出。在神经网络中,参数可以理解为神经元的连接权重。
2. 参数的数量
大模型的参数数量通常以亿、千亿甚至万亿为单位。例如,GPT-3模型拥有1750亿参数,而BERT模型则拥有数亿参数。
3. 参数的重要性
参数数量对模型的性能有着直接的影响。参数越多,模型越有可能捕捉到复杂的数据特征,从而提高模型的准确性和泛化能力。
二、大模型的训练过程
1. 数据集
大模型的训练需要大量的数据集。这些数据集通常来自互联网、公开数据库或通过采集等方式获取。
2. 训练算法
常用的训练算法包括随机梯度下降(SGD)、Adam、LSTM等。这些算法通过不断调整参数,使模型在训练数据上达到最优性能。
3. 计算资源
大模型的训练需要大量的计算资源,包括高性能GPU、TPU等。此外,还需要高速网络和大容量的存储系统。
4. 训练时间
大模型的训练周期通常较长,可能需要数天、数周甚至数月。
三、大模型的应用场景
1. 自然语言处理
大模型在自然语言处理领域具有广泛的应用,如机器翻译、文本摘要、问答系统等。
2. 计算机视觉
大模型在计算机视觉领域也取得了显著成果,如图像识别、目标检测、视频分析等。
3. 语音识别
大模型在语音识别领域具有很高的准确率,可以应用于语音助手、语音翻译等场景。
四、大模型面临的挑战
1. 计算资源消耗
大模型的训练需要大量的计算资源,这对数据中心和云计算平台提出了挑战。
2. 训练时间
大模型的训练周期较长,难以满足实时性要求。
3. 模型可解释性
随着模型参数的增加,大模型的决策过程变得难以理解和解释,这对模型的可靠性、安全性以及监管合规性提出了挑战。
4. 数据隐私
大模型的训练和应用涉及大量数据,如何保护数据隐私成为了一个重要问题。
五、总结
大模型在人工智能领域具有巨大的潜力,但同时也面临着诸多挑战。随着技术的不断发展,相信这些问题将会得到解决,大模型将会在更多领域发挥重要作用。